Remedy Entertainment’s Quantum Break reaches its fifth anniversary, and the developer and fans are celebrating the unique action game.

Remedy Entertainment’s Quantum Break was delivered in 2016 as an Xbox Elite game. It is currently five years old, and the developers, alongside the fans, are praising the extraordinary sci-fi action experience game.

Quantum Break was delivered to common good surveys five years prior, and the time-bending activity blended in with true-to-life cutscenes, which helped set the game apart. The developer has buckled down on creating games since Quantum Break, including 2019’s Control; however, many have a weakness for Quantum Break. Lennie Hakola, a senior producer at Remedy Entertainment, recently tweeted out a celebratory post about the game that Hakola claims he emptied everything into.

Remedy Entertainment has consistently been grateful to its fans regarding Quantum Break and its games, and Hakola says that Quantum Break, specifically, is a game that will consistently be unforgettable to him. Many fans commend the five-year commemoration of Quantum Break.

Many accept that the game is underestimated, which might be valid, as it is likely not considered the top Remedy Entertainment game. In any case, even close to any semblance of Max Payne, Alan Wake, and now Control, Quantum Break stands apart as a remarkable and unique title.

The Game Awards additionally broke in on Twitter during the festival. Even though Quantum Break didn’t bring home The Game Awards prizes as Control did, it investigated rather well and was valued.

Quantum Break is available now on PC and Xbox One.
